About Shuohong Wang
Shuohong Wang is a scholar working on Computer Vision and Pattern Recognition, Computer Networks and Communications, Artificial Intelligence, Aerospace Engineering and Civil and Structural Engineering, having authored 14 papers that have together received 49 indexed citations. Recurring topics across this work include Robotics and Sensor-Based Localization (2 papers), Visual Attention and Saliency Detection (2 papers), AI in cancer detection (2 papers), Water Systems and Optimization (2 papers), Infrastructure Maintenance and Monitoring (2 papers), Distributed Control Multi-Agent Systems (2 papers), Lung Cancer Diagnosis and Treatment (2 papers) and Radiomics and Machine Learning in Medical Imaging (2 papers). The work is most often cited by research in Civil and Structural Engineering (18 citations), Industrial and Manufacturing Engineering (8 citations), Critical Care and Intensive Care Medicine (3 citations), Computer Vision and Pattern Recognition (9 citations) and Environmental Engineering (6 citations). Shuohong Wang has collaborated with scholars based in China, United States and Switzerland. Frequent co-authors include Xiang Liu, Xing Zhang, Jiawei Zhang, Ye Liu, Yan Qiu Chen, Jianquan Zhang, Xing Zhang, Lei Tian, Yiwen Liu and Illés J. Farkas. Their work appears in journals such as Applied Sciences, Computers in Biology and Medicine, Scientific Reports, Chemical Senses and Biomedical Signal Processing and Control.
